  • Danny Howells returns to The End this Friday for another of his Dig Deeper nights. Pace yourself because this time he'll be hogging the decks for seven not six hours! It's almost a year since Danny Howells first launched his Dig Deeper marathon sets at The End. The residency was set up to enable Danny to plunder the depths of his eclectic and sizable record collection over the course of a whole night rather than try and squeeze it all in in a two hour set. Since then Danny has taken the Dig Deeper concept as far as Miami and Tokyo but despite the increasing number of overtime shifts there's no sign of him cutting back on his hours just yet. The first Dig Deeper night at The End last August was plugged as an all nighter with the host on the decks for six hours. But latest news from The End hints that this time around Danny will be going even deeper. In press for the night, Danny promises, "more silliness...along with seven hours of my favourite music from downtempo deep house through to techno." Along with his usual bundle of house and disco, those heading to The End should keep an ear out for Danny's recent remix of Madonna's 'Get Together' made with production partner Dick Trevor. Failing that, Danny will most likely bang the crap out of it with a swag of "terribly unfashionable" techno, as he once put it. Danny Howells plays The End this Friday, July 28, 2006.
